This is one of those times I wish there were a half star option but alas. The ambiance of the place is great - nice decor, dimly lit, perfect for a nice dinner or date night. The service was wonderful as everyone was super nice and helpful. Unfortunately the food is where we took a downturn and I didn't feel the prices of the dishes/drinks were justified. Drinks - margarita and old fashioned were ok however not even half the glass was full for the OF with the ice cube, not nearly worth the price Lobster wonton - nothing that you probably haven't had before but good Negi toro maki - not bad, not great. Wouldn't order again Miso glazed Chilean sea bass - actually almost inedible due to the overly sweet miso butter emulsion on top, would not pay $20 let alone $48 Sichuan chili chicken - this was the most enjoyable dish and actually tasty, only thing I'd return for

To start, the aesthetics of this place are really beautiful. It's clean and there is a choice of both indoor and outdoor seating. I came for lunch around 12 and there was only one other table. The service is attentive which is great. For lunch, I had the Philly egg rolls and the Sichuan chili chicken with a side of Furikake rice. The presentation was beautiful! The chicken was crispy and fresh. The reason why I'm giving for stars is two-fold: first, although the food is fresh and looks like it's well seasoned, to me both the chicken and the philly egg rolls were underseasoned. Furthermore, the lunch prices are just a tad bit high for Gainesville, by like 1-3 bucks. All if the lunch entrees are a la carte and the Furikake rice was $3. A side of white rice is only $1 (it's not on the menu) so essentially you're paying 2 extra bucks for them to sprinkle some sushi seasoning on top of it.
